Due to its geographic position at the centre of the North Coast of Sardinia, Castelsardo is a charming place where you can pass peaceful holidays and have tours throughout the Island.
Castelsardo is just more than 30 Km from Porto Torres and about 50 Km from the airport of Alghero/Fertilia.
People arriving from Olbia or Golfo Aranci harbours or from Olbia/costa Smeralda airport can reach it within an hour by car.
People arriving from Corsica to Santa Teresa can reach Castelsardo within an hour by car.
For those wishing to reach our beautiful island by ferry, there are new links of Saremar, the regional shipping company. Castelsardo is a fortified, medieval borought which has kept its ancient charm for over 900 years. When it was founded by the powerful Doria family in 1102, it was named “Castelgenovese”. In 1448, having been taken over by the Aragonese, it was renamed, “Castellaragonese”. It was the Savoia family who gave the town its present name in the 1700s.The castle, city walls and the Aragonese tower of the beautiful Cathedral of Sant’Antonio Abate soar out of the trachyte cliffs and their sheer drop to the sea a sight which gives this place a magical beauty which has always charmed anyone who visits, making them want to return again soon.Castelsardo is the ideal place for the sea lovers. In fact the particular characteristics of the coast line offer the choice between fine sandy beaches such as “La Marina”, and the shores of “Lu bagnu”, “La Vignaccia” and “Baia Ostina”and rocky coves such as “Pedraladda”, “Manganella” and “Punta La Craba”: everywhere, the clear, coloured waters make you want to dive in. The splendid sea and its seafloor which is one of the most impressive in the Mediterranean would tempt anyone to go scuba diving. It is also an ideal place for sailing and windsurfing. But the town offers facilities for basketball, volleyball, tennis, football, five a side and other sports. There are also play ground.
The area round Castelsardo is ideal for memorable excursions on foot,by bike or on a horse.The countryside is rich in woods,perfumed Mediterranean shrubs, sheer cliffs, parks and enchanting views with impressive sunsets.
